2001 thermostat F150 4x4 WTF
i have a 01 F150 4.6L 4x4 with 243K on it...I have never changed the thermostat in it and I am the orginal owner...pulled it apart saturday and a bolt runs into the intake and one into the head..aluminum parts and steel bolts...they wont budge and I was afraid of breaking them any suggestions or should I take it to a shop? I have heat it just take it about 20minutes to get there.
#2
I had to change the t-stat on my 01 crew cab the weeknd before christmas it was the first time it had been changed too, my bolts were shoulder bolts (looks like a washer under the head) and I was able to put a socket on and a long extension with a little 3/8 breaker bar and apply steady pressure while tapping down on the back of the breaker bar with a hammer, the jarring seemed to help it loosen, but both of my bolts went through the intake and in to the engine, one bolt came right out but the other took the persuading. This is just my experiance if you don't think they'll come out without breaking let some one else do it or proceed with extreme caution.
